Understanding DHA-Free Self-Tanning

Decoding DHA-Free Formulations in Self-Tanners

If you're venturing into the world of luxury cosmetics, you'll probably encounter the term DHA-free self-tanning. Understanding what it truly implies can elevate your sunless tanning experience. DHA, or dihydroxyacetone, is a common ingredient in traditional self-tanners, responsible for triggering a chemical reaction with the amino acids in the skin’s surface. This creates the tan effect, akin to a sun-kissed glow. However, the allure of DHA-free products lies in their composition, crafted to cater for those with sensitive skin or those seeking a more "natural" alternative. Often composed of organic ingredients like aloe vera, these products promise to minimize adverse reactions while still enhancing your tan with a natural radiance. Application Tips for a Flawless Finish

Achieving A Seamless Self-Tan

For those who are enamored with luxury cosmetics, the application process of a DHA-free self-tanner is a ritual in itself. It's crucial to follow a few simple steps to ensure that your self tanning experience leaves you with a natural, sun-kissed glow you desire.

  • Preparation is Key: Start by exfoliating your skin 24 hours prior to applying the tanning product. This helps remove dead skin cells, allowing the self tanner to be evenly absorbed, reducing the risk of patchiness. Products with organic ingredients, like a gentle aloe vera scrub, are highly recommended, especially for those with sensitive skin.
  • Choose Your Product Wisely: Selecting the right formulation—be it a moisturizing lotion, a light tanning mousse, or an indulgent sunless tanner—based on your skin type and desired outcome is crucial. Select a DHA-free solution that caters to your needs while providing a safe and effective tan.
  • Even Application: Use an applicator mitt to achieve a streak-free finish. Apply the DHA-free self-tanner in circular motions, starting with lower legs and working upwards, to ensure even coverage and a natural-looking color.
  • Drying Time: Allow adequate time for the tanning product to dry before dressing. This will help prevent transfer onto clothes and ensure the tan sets evenly. Typically, luxury products have quick-drying formulations, which can be a boon for the modern, time-conscious user.
  • Aftercare: To maintain your tan, moisturize daily with an organic, nourishing lotion to keep skin hydrated and prolong the glow. Reapply the tan every few days to keep your radiant glow intact.
